Diffraction

Diffraction is the phenomenon of a wave, such as light or sound, spreading out and bending around obstacles or through small openings. This bending and spreading occurs when the wave encounters an obstruction or aperture that is comparable in size to the wavelength of the wave. Diffraction can result in interference patterns, such as those seen in the colorful bands produced by light passing through a narrow slit or around a sharp edge. This phenomenon is fundamental to understanding the behavior of waves and is commonly studied in the fields of physics, optics, and acoustics.
